so i forgot to take chicken casserole puree out of freezer last night. It is in a tupperware bowl because ds eats quite a lot. Nothing for supper tonight unless i heat it up from frozen. Well, except toast and fruit, he doesn't like much else [except for lamb casserole and i haven't got any lamb at mo.] Is it safe to heat up from frozen if i cook it for a few minutes? Or should i leave it till it thaws properly? Sorry!

OP posts:
Feistybird · 08/11/2005 16:27

you can defrost in a micro - I wouldn't heat up directly. Or you can put the bowl in some cold water which will speed up defrosting.
